HG65 BGE is a 2015 Volkswagen Tiguan in White with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 100%.
Across all 2015 Volkswagen Tiguan models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.0% with a typical mileage of 55,006 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Tiguan f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,258 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HG65 BGE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Tiguan typ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 11 years old, this Volkswagen Tiguan is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
